Technical Specifications
| Model | Asia-Teco A5 |
| Attendance Type | Fingerprint / Password |
| Display | 2.4" TFT Colour Screen |
| Data Transfer | USB Flash Drive |
| Power Supply | 5V 1A DC |
| Operating Temperature | 0–55°C |
| Operating Humidity | 60–90% RH |
| Device Dimensions | 285mm × 128mm × 52mm |
| Languages | English, Chinese, Malaysian, Indonesian |
| Country of Origin | Made in China |

Why Choose Biometric Attendance?
Traditional paper timesheets and PIN-only clocks are vulnerable to "buddy punching" — employees clocking in on behalf of absent colleagues. A biometric fingerprint system eliminates this by tying every clock-in to a unique, verified fingerprint.
